Part 1

How did you learn to be polite as a child?

分数: 45.0

建议: 问题回答不够连贯,语法和词汇错误较多,导致意思模糊。建议: 1) 直接用一句主题句回答问题,例如“I learned politeness mainly from my parents.”(一句话回答,清晰) 2) 使用一到两个支持细节说明方式,使用连接词(for example, they taught me… and they corrected me…)。 3) 注意常用词汇和拼写(punish, polite, remind, elderly, corrected),避免重复和冗余,句子不要超过5句。练习时先写下要点再口述。

示例: I learned to be polite mainly from my parents. For example, they led by example and always reminded me to greet and help elderly people. They also taught me to say “please” and “thank you,” and they gently corrected me when I behaved rudely. As a result, I developed good manners both at home and at school.

Do you think being polite is very important?

分数: 50.0

建议: 回答立场明确但词汇和表达错误影响理解。建议: 1) 用一至两句直接表达观点,再用一到两句具体举例或解释(use linking words like because, for example)。 2) 注意常见词汇拼写与搭配(rude, polite, lend something to someone)。 3) 保持句子简洁,避免多余重复;在练习中尝试录音并比照原句改正错误。

示例: Yes, I think being polite is very important because it helps build good relationships. For example, if you lend something to someone and they return it with a thank you, it makes both people feel respected and happy.
